Abstract

One of the important and vital role is played by army soldiers for the security purpose of our country, many instruments are mounted on them to view their health status by using bio-sensor systems comprising various types of small physiological sensors, transmission modules .GPS used to log the longitude and latitude of soldier and GSM module can be used for wireless communications that will be required to relay information on situational awareness .So by using these equipment’s we are trying to implement the life- guarding system for soldier in low cost and higher reliability, if soldier is in unconscious state the visual alerts are generated in the soldiers wearable materials.
